About UvA

The University of Amsterdam is one of Europe's leading research universities, ranked in the world's top 60, with particular strength in psychology, economics, communication and artificial intelligence.

The Netherlands teaches more degrees in English than any other non-anglophone country, and the one-year orientation visa lets graduates stay to find work.
